All good advice, i mean its a tournament and a Big one you want to play super tight super aggressive, but when blinds are low like the other guy said i would try to sneak in low pairs and def suited connectors, on button late positon ect.

Get your money in when you have the best of it and protect it when you don't. If your new to tournament poker. The Best book series i ever read on it was Dan Harringtons "Harrington on Hold'em" 3 book series on tournament poker. A valuable piece of literature. Turned me into a winning tournament player after i read it. And i still reread it every now and again to stay sharp.

Is this a Pokerstars Freeroll? just curious cause im a Us player and would be interested in qualifying for it someday.

-A
It is on PokerStars, although there's not actually $100k in the prizepool. There's a whole lot of $1k freerolls during a month where you can either deposit in a way (can't remember exactly what bonuscode (or if you need one)) OR you can reach Chromestar and buy access to those freerolls in the VIP Store for 0 points.
The access to the tournaments when you buy as Chromestar last for one day, where you can play the tournaments and buy access again after that whereas it's 1 month if you deposit. The total prizepool if you play them all in a month is just about $100k - which I guess is their reasoning for the tournament name :)
